Our Review of Sæta Svínið Gastropub

Sæta Svínið Gastropub is a fantastic place to eat in Reykjavik. It's right in the heart of downtown, which makes it super convenient if you're exploring the city. The atmosphere is lively and welcoming, with a warm wooden interior that feels cozy. The patio is a great spot to sit when the weather is nice, offering a view of the Ingólfur Square. The food here is top-notch.

They serve a range of dishes that include everything from hearty burgers to unique Icelandic platters. The beef comes highly recommended, an should be tender yet flavorful. The menu has a good variety, so you can go for a full meal or just grab a quick snack. Prices are on the higher side, but the quality makes it worth it. The drink selection at Sæta Svínið is impressive, featuring a variety of Icelandic beers and spirits.

They have a daily happy hour where you can get half-price drinks, which is a nice perk. The staff is very knowledgeable about the drinks and can help you pick something you'll enjoy. It's a great place to relax with a drink after a day of sightseeing. Service is excellent, with staff like Emma and Rúnar making sure you have a great experience. They're friendly and attentive, which really adds to the overall positive vibe of the place.

The only small downside is the size of the tables - they can be a bit cramped if you're with a larger group. Sæta Svínið Gastropub for the most part is definitely worth checking out because of its great food, drinks, and vibe.

When to Visit

If you want to experience Sæta Svínið Gastropub without the crowd, try going for a late lunch. The place opens at 11:30 AM, so arriving a bit after the lunch rush can give you a more relaxed dining experience. Evenings are lively, especially with their daily happy hour, but it can get a bit busy, so keep that in mind if you prefer a quieter meal.
